Amon Tobin



I went to see Amon Tobin Friday night, this is one of the videos and pictures I took. I have listened to his music for many years and was very excited to see him playing in San Francisco.
It was a pretty good concert, but he only played one song I had heard before which was a bummer. I didn't mind the lack of familiarity though since he is very good at using neat sounds, rhythms and a variety of textures. Only a few times did he digress so far into experimental trance/techno that I found myself yawing.

Most of his stuff is sick samplings that he mixes together: Hip-Hop, Electronic, Jazz, Classical and weird sounds from the Foley room.

iTunes says: "He excels at creating an atmosphere of approaching menace, with short passages of dramatic samples and anxious strings paving way for another array of pummeling beats."

Mr. Mom reports

I have noticed a more alert Lucia lately. She seems more attentive and notices things more readily now than before Christmas which is cool, but at the same time she require more attention and she is um.. controlling: She has to have her hands on the bottle now and she is using them to pull it out and push it back in when she is ready for more. (See photo)
She also likes to look at Mrs. Baylee and she likes to touch her, if she's within reach.

Another more disappointing development is her beginning aversion toward the pacifier. I think it reminds her of having to go to sleep and she will have nothing of it! The trick is to see when she may want it and introduce it then.
It is funny to watch: one second she hates it, the next she is like loving it and her eyes are rolling, its magic.

I have noticed all kinds of small details now that I spend so much more time with her and I am getting better at "reading" her, understanding and anticipating what she needs.
Reading the sleep book was also an eye-opener to me, no wait! It has been an eye-closer! Some of the things it suggested was counter intuitive but it works! Perhaps she is just reaching that age now when she is starting to sleep longer during the night?
